Galangal and Coconut Soup
A creamy and fragrant soup made with boiled galangal, coconut milk, and fresh herbs, perfect for a light meal.
- 2 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up coconut milk
- 1/2 cup boiled galangal, sliced
- 1 cup mushrooms, sliced
- 1 cup spinach
- 1 tablespoon lime juice
- Fresh cilantro for garnish
- In a pot, bring the vegetable broth to a simmer and add the sliced galangal and mushrooms.
- Stir in the coconut milk and let it simmer for 10 minutes.
- Add spinach and lime juice, cook for another 2 minutes, and garnish with cilantro before serving.

Galangal and Lentil Curry
A hearty lentil curry enriched with the unique flavor of boiled galangal, perfect for a nutritious dinner.
- 1 cup lentils, rinsed
- 1/2 cup boiled galangal, diced
- 1 can coconut milk
- 1 cup vegetable broth
- 1 tablespoon curry powder
- 1 onion, chopped
- Salt to taste
- In a pot, sauté the onion until translucent, then add the boiled galangal and curry powder.
- Stir in the lentils, coconut milk, and vegetable broth, bringing it to a boil.
- Reduce heat and simmer for 25-30 minutes until lentils are tender, seasoning with salt before serving.

Galangal-Infused Vegetable Broth
A flavorful vegetable broth infused with boiled galangal, perfect as a base for soups or enjoyed on its own.
- 4 cups water
- 1/2 cup boiled galangal, sliced
- 1 onion, quartered
- 2 carrots, chopped
- 2 celery stalks, chopped
- Salt to taste
- In a large pot, combine water, sliced galangal, onion, carrots, and celery.
-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 30-40 minutes.
- Strain the broth, season with salt, and use as desired.
